Kerala Agricultural University and Annamalai University's placement data suggest that both colleges provide good placement chances. Kerala Agricultural University announced a median package of INR 1.82 LPA for Integrated BSc courses in 2022 and INR 3.60 LPA for PG (2-year) courses. During its 2020 placements, Annamalai University had an average package of INR 4.5 LPA. While specific course statistics may not be available, both colleges have a track record of putting their students in respected companies. When making a decision, students must evaluate the placement statistics of the specific courses they are interested in, as well as other variables such as curriculum, faculty, and industry exposure.

To be eligible for MBA admission at Kerala Agricultural University in 2023, candidates must have a bachelor's degree under the regular stream with at least 60% marks in aggregate (55% marks for SC/ST candidates) The candidates who are keen to
...more
To be eligible for MBA admission at Kerala Agricultural University in 2023, candidates must have a bachelor's degree under the regular stream with at least 60% marks in aggregate (55% marks for SC/ST candidates) The candidates who are keen to seek admission in MBA course need to qualify any of the following tests- KMAT, CAT, CMAT, or MAT. Usually, these tests are conducted in the month of December or January. Kerala Agriculture University invites application for MBA in Agriculture Business Management only after the declaration of results of the above mentioned tests. Admissions to the course are made on the basis of the scores in KMAT, CAT, CMAT or MAT.Based on the previous year's trends, candidates who score above 450-500 marks in KMAT are likely to have a good chance of getting admission to the MBA programme at Kerala University. It's important to note that the cutoff may vary depending on the category of the candidate, the number of applicants, and the number of seats available.It's recommended to keep checking the official website of Kerala University and the KMAT website for the latest updates and announcements related to the MBA admission cutoff.

Kerala Agricultural University's (KAU) MBA programme costs are as follows:The one-time admission fee is Rs 5,000.One-time College Caution Deposit: Rs 2,500The tuition fee is Rs 25,000 every semester.Additional fees include those for the librar
...more
Kerala Agricultural University's (KAU) MBA programme costs are as follows:The one-time admission fee is Rs 5,000.One-time College Caution Deposit: Rs 2,500The tuition fee is Rs 25,000 every semester.Additional fees include those for the library, medical examinations, stationery, textbooks and calendars, athletics, associations, magazines, university unions, exams, degree certificates, provisional degree certificates, transcripts, e-learning, one-time PTA contributions, laptops, and placement funds. varying goods at varying amounts The total course fee for the MBA programme at KAU is Rs 52,750 for the 1st semester, Rs 28,900 for the 2nd and 3rd semesters, and Rs 32,600 for the 4th semester.A one time contribution of Rs.5000 has to be paid in lump sum to the PTA at the time of admission and a one time contribution of Rs.10,000 is to be paid in lump sum to the placement cell at the time of admissionThe fee structure of my college was well organized and feasible. Relaxation was also provided to students of reserved category and with weak economical backgrounds. Scholarships were also provided to some deserving students.

In terms of placements, the University has been able to mantain a decent record. The table below mentions the course-wise total students and the number of students placed during Kerala Agricultural University placements from 2021 to 2023:CourseTotal Students/ Students Placed (2021)Total Students/ Students Placed (2022)Total Students/ Students Placed (2023)BTech/ BSc336/ 34525/ 61546/ 106Integrated BSc36/ 826/ 134/ 2PG (2-year)161/ 57192/ 28173/ 86NOTE: The above statistics are gathered from the NIRF report 2024.
